Medical sales can be a lucrative job, but it depends on a number of factors, including the specific products or services being sold, the
company or industry sector, and the individual's sales performance.
According to data from the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the
median annual salary for medical and pharmaceutical sales representatives in
2020 was $71,840. However, the top 10 percent of medical sales representatives
earned more than $187,199 per year, which is a significant earning potential.
Additionally, the medical sales industry is expected to grow
in the coming years.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, employment of
medical and pharmaceutical sales representatives is projected to grow 3 percent
from 2020 to 2030, about as fast as the average for all occupations.
